    Factors Influencing the Imini Dirt Bike Price

    Okay, let's break down the main things that determine the Imini dirt bike price. This is where we get into the nitty-gritty to help you understand what you're actually paying for. It's like learning the secret recipe before you start cooking! Knowing these details will help you spot a good deal and avoid overspending.

    • Model: Imini makes different models, each designed for a specific type of rider or riding style. Some models are geared towards kids or beginners, while others are built for more experienced riders. The more advanced the model, the more features and tech it’ll likely have, and that will reflect in the Imini dirt bike price. For example, a basic model designed for younger riders will be cheaper than a high-performance bike with a bigger engine and better suspension.
    • Engine Size: This is a biggie! The engine size (measured in cubic centimeters, or cc) dramatically affects performance and, of course, the Imini dirt bike price. A 50cc bike will be much cheaper than a 125cc or 250cc model. The bigger the engine, the more power and speed you get, but also the higher the price. Consider your skill level and where you'll be riding. If you're just starting, a smaller engine is a great choice. If you’re looking to hit some serious jumps and trails, you might want to consider a larger engine. But remember, the larger the engine, the more you can expect to pay for the Imini dirt bike.
    • New vs. Used: Like any vehicle, a used Imini dirt bike will be significantly cheaper than a brand-new one. However, buying used means you need to do your homework. Check the bike's condition carefully! Look for signs of wear and tear, and ask about its maintenance history. If you're not mechanically inclined, bringing a friend who knows about bikes is always a good idea. New bikes come with a warranty and the peace of mind that everything is working perfectly. However, the Imini dirt bike price is obviously higher. Weigh the pros and cons to see what makes the most sense for you.
    • Condition: If you're buying used, the condition is crucial. A bike in excellent condition will cost more than one that needs repairs. Inspect the tires, brakes, suspension, engine, and frame. Any damage or necessary repairs will impact the Imini dirt bike price and should be factored into your decision. Be realistic about your budget. Factor in any potential costs for repairs or replacements. You might save money upfront by buying a bike in rough shape, but you could end up spending more in the long run if it requires significant work.
    • Features and Upgrades: Some Imini dirt bikes come with added features like upgraded suspension, electric start, or better tires. These features will bump up the Imini dirt bike price, but they can also enhance your riding experience. Decide what features are important to you. Do you need a bike with a powerful engine, or are you looking for something that is easy to handle? Electric start is convenient, but not essential. Better suspension can make a huge difference, especially on rough terrain. Prioritize the features that best suit your riding style and needs.
    • Market Demand and Availability: Sometimes, the Imini dirt bike price will fluctuate based on supply and demand. If a particular model is hot right now, or if there aren’t many bikes available, prices might be higher. This is something to consider, especially if you have your heart set on a specific model. Check with several sellers and compare prices to see what's a fair deal.

    Budgeting for Your Imini Dirt Bike

    Okay, let's talk about the cold, hard cash. Knowing how much you should budget for an Imini dirt bike price is super important. This will help you narrow down your choices and avoid any surprises. Let’s break it down.

    • New Bikes: Expect to pay somewhere between $800 to $2000+ for a brand-new Imini dirt bike, depending on the model, engine size, and features. Higher-end models and those with larger engines will naturally be at the higher end of the price range. Remember, this is just the base price. You’ll also need to factor in additional costs. Don’t forget to include sales tax in your budget!
    • Used Bikes: You can often find used Imini dirt bikes for significantly less. Prices can range from a few hundred dollars to over a thousand dollars, depending on the condition, model, and year. Be prepared to potentially spend more on repairs if you purchase a bike that needs some work. Always do a thorough inspection before buying a used bike.
    • Additional Costs: Don't forget the extra costs! You'll need to factor in the price of gear (helmet, boots, gloves, and riding apparel), any necessary repairs or maintenance, and possibly transportation. Consider the cost of ongoing maintenance, such as oil changes and tire replacements. A good quality helmet is a must-have! Factor in the costs of gear, insurance, and any necessary riding courses. If you’re a beginner, a riding course is definitely worth the investment.
    • Financing Options: Some dealerships and retailers offer financing options. This can make it easier to afford a bike, but always be aware of the interest rates and repayment terms. Make sure you can comfortably handle the monthly payments before committing to a loan. Compare offers from different lenders to find the best deal. Always read the fine print!

    Tips for Getting the Best Deal on an Imini Dirt Bike

    Want to snag the best possible deal on your Imini dirt bike price? Here are some tips and tricks to help you save some money and get a great bike. You can find some amazing deals if you do a bit of homework!

    • Do Your Research: Before you start shopping, research different Imini models and their prices. This will help you understand what a fair price is and spot any potential deals. Check out online reviews and forums to get an idea of what other riders think of different models. Knowing the market will put you in a better position to negotiate. Take your time and compare prices from different sources.
    • Be Prepared to Negotiate: Don’t be afraid to negotiate, especially when buying used. Dealers and private sellers often have some wiggle room in their prices. Do your homework to determine a fair price. Don’t be afraid to walk away if the seller isn’t willing to meet your price. Always be polite but firm in your negotiations.
    • Consider the Time of Year: You might find better deals during the off-season. Demand for dirt bikes is usually lower during the winter months. Dealers and private sellers may be more willing to negotiate to clear out inventory. Keep an eye out for seasonal sales and promotions. Plan your purchase accordingly.
    • Inspect Carefully: If you're buying used, inspect the bike carefully. Look for any signs of damage or wear and tear. Ask the seller about the bike's maintenance history. A thorough inspection can help you avoid buying a bike that will need expensive repairs. If you're not sure what to look for, bring a friend who is mechanically inclined.
    • Don’t Be Afraid to Walk Away: If something feels off or the price isn’t right, don’t be afraid to walk away. There are always other bikes out there. Never feel pressured to make a purchase. Trust your gut. Waiting for the right bike to come along is always better than settling for a bad deal.
